Blogs
Time vs. Quality: Why we should Rethink Deadlines in Software Development
Which is more important in software development: delivering a product as quickly as possible or delivering the best possible product? I believe the latter is more important.
In this blog post, I'll explore why we should reconsider our approach to software development, particularly regarding the balance between quality and time. Quality should always take precedence over speed.
Beyond Best Practices: Why Context-Driven Testing is Key to Effective Software Development
In this blog post, we’ll explore the seven principles of Context-Driven Testing. By understanding these principles, you’ll see how this approach can guide your testing efforts to be more flexible, relevant, and successful. Dive in to learn why context is king in the world of software testing and how you can apply these principles to your projects.
Crafting Chaos: The Ultimate Guide for Creating the Worst Software Ever
Dive into the guide to crafting terrible software! I flip the script, revealing how disregarding users, evading testing, and embracing chaos can lead to spectacularly awful software. This journey through the anti-best practices in software development is a must-read for anyone seeking a laugh and a fresh perspective. Remember, it's all in good fun!